Frequently asked questions
What is a Kaffir Lime Leaf?
Kaffir lime leaf is a popular ingredient in Southeast Asian cooking, particularly Thai recipes. It comes from the kaffir lime tree and is known for its aromatic and unique flavor.
Can I substitute kaffir lime leaves?
Yes, you can use bay leaves, citrus zest or a combination of both, though the taste might not be exactly the same.
Are kaffir lime leaves edible?
Yes, kaffir lime leaves are edible but they are often used for flavor and removed before eating, as they could be tough and fibrous.
What is the taste of kaffir lime leaves?
Kaffir lime leaves have a strong citrus flavor, and are slightly bitter.
Can kaffir lime leaves be dried?
Yes, you can dry kaffir lime leaves for storage, but keep in mind that they will lose some of their flavor.
What dishes commonly use kaffir lime leaves?
Kaffir lime leaves are popularly used in many Thai dishes, including soups, curries, and stir-fries.
Are there health benefits to eating kaffir lime leaves?
Yes, kaffir lime leaves are packed with antioxidants, and are believed to promote oral health as well as detoxify the blood.
How to prepare kaffir lime leaves for cooking?
To prepare kaffir lime leaves for cooking, rinse them under cool water and pat dry. You can then remove the central stem and finely chop the leaves or leave them whole, depending on your recipe.

How to store kaffir lime leaves?
Kaffir lime leaves can be stored in a cool, dry place, or in the refrigerator. They can also be frozen for long-term storage.
How to use kaffir lime leaves in cooking?
You can use whole leaves to infuse dishes with their aroma, or chop them finely and add to your recipe. Remember to remove whole leaves before serving.
Can I grow kaffir lime trees at home?
Yes, kaffir lime trees can be grown at home with the right conditions, including ample sunlight and well-drained soil.
Are kaffir lime leaves the same as lime leaves?
Not exactly. While they come from similar family, kaffir lime leaves have unique flavor and aroma compared to regular lime leaves.
Can I freeze kaffir lime leaves?
Yes, kaffir lime leaves can be frozen to extend their shelf-life.
What are other names for kaffir lime?
Other names for kaffir lime include Thai lime, wild lime, kieffer lime, and makrut lime.
Does kaffir lime leaves have any side effects?
Kaffir lime leaves are generally safe for consumption. However, if you’re pregnant or breastfeeding, it’s best to consult your doctor before adding them to your diet.
